Which two superpowers were caught in an arms race during the Cold War, as they competed with each other to acquire advanced weap

onry and build up their militaries?

The answer is: The United States and the Soviet Union.

Democratic America and the communist Soviet Union engaged in an extent of time of political strain between 1946 and 1991, which started when the U.S. launched a policy to prevent Soviet and communist expansion.

Although the conflict did not involve major fighting, The U.S. provided support and military forces to assist countries threatened by communism.
